Seismic Design Aids for Nonlinear Analysis of Reinforced Concrete by Giorgio, Luciano , and Chandrasekaran

Nonlinear analysis methods such as static pushover are globally considered a reliable tool for seismic and structural assessment. But the accuracy of seismic capacity estimates—which can prevent catastrophic loss of life and astronomical damage repair costs—depends on the use of the correct basic input parameters.
